Re: airprint.device status
Home away from home
Home away from home


@mcleppa

Nice

Nope, no file created, but Snoopy tells me
Quote:

02301 : AirScan : FAIL = Open("RAM:T/Airscan/scannerstatus",NEW) = [0x00000000] [32uS]


and i now know why...i don't have a T subir in RAM:

I redirected everything that goes to T: to a hdd partition.

Since you don't write to T:, but rather to the absolute path, it fails.
Seems i need to enhance my redirection to include writes to RAM:T/ then

...


and now the printer wakes up and scans..woohoo

Thanks a lot for the hint

Re: updating sgit
Home away from home
Home away from home


@all

Since some people are still using libgit (i hope), does anyone else get SSL errors as of late aswell?

Whenever i want to clone or fetch updates from ScummVM i get
libgit error (12): SSL error: unknown error

sgit clone https://github.com/scummvm/scummvm scummvm
net   4% (15074 kb62385/1266004)  /  idx   4% (60241/1266004)  /  chk   0% (   0/   0)
libgit error (12): SSL errorunknown error

same with "sgit fetch origin"...

Funny enough, it will work on the tools subproject (maybe it's the size?)

This happened after updating to AmiSSL 5.12

Certificates are from 12/12/2023

Thank you very much in advance
